The Argentina Edible Packaging Market is experiencing growth driven by increasing environmental concerns and a shift towards sustainable packaging solutions. Consumers are seeking eco-friendly alternatives to traditional packaging materials, leading to a rising demand for edible packaging options made from natural ingredients such as seaweed, rice, and corn starch. Major players in the market are investing in research and development to innovate and expand their product offerings, catering to the growing trend of conscious consumerism. The market is also witnessing collaborations between packaging companies and food manufacturers to develop customized edible packaging solutions that align with specific product requirements. Government initiatives promoting sustainability and reducing plastic waste are further propelling the adoption of edible packaging in Argentina.

In the Argentina Edible Packaging Market, several challenges are faced, including limited consumer awareness and acceptance of edible packaging as a viable alternative to traditional packaging materials. Additionally, there are difficulties in ensuring the scalability and cost-effectiveness of edible packaging solutions to compete with conventional options. Regulatory hurdles related to food safety and labeling requirements also pose challenges for companies looking to enter the market. Furthermore, the need for specialized technology and expertise in developing and producing edible packaging materials adds complexity to the industry. Overcoming these challenges will require education and awareness campaigns, innovation in production processes, collaboration with regulatory bodies, and investment in research and development to enhance the performance and attractiveness of edible packaging solutions to both consumers and businesses.

In Argentina, government policies related to the edible packaging market focus on sustainability and environmental protection. The government has implemented regulations to encourage the use of biodegradable and compostable materials in packaging to reduce waste and minimize environmental impact. Additionally, there are initiatives to support research and development in the field of edible packaging, promoting innovation and the adoption of new technologies. The government also provides incentives and subsidies to companies investing in sustainable packaging solutions, aiming to create a more eco-friendly and competitive market. Overall, Argentina`s policies aim to drive the growth of the edible packaging market while prioritizing sustainability and environmental responsibility.
